About Brian Y. Hong

Brian Y. Hong is a scholar working on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ine, Applied Microbiology and Biotechnology and Emergency Medicine, having authored 20 papers that have together received 331 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Pain Management and Opioid Use (2 papers), Poisoning and overdose treatments (2 papers) and Cannabis and Cannabinoid Research (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Applied Microbiology and Biotechnology (13 citations),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ine (24 citations) and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health (75 citations). Brian Y. Hong has collaborated with scholars based in Canada,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Chris J. Hong, Jason W. Busse, Rachel Couban, Jetan H. Badhiwala, Sean A. Kennedy, Jay Riva-Cambrin, Li Wang, Henry Y. Kwon, Abhaya V. Kulkarni and Farshad Nassiri.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, American Journal Of Pathology and British Journal of Ophthalmology.
